BT10 OPX is a 2010 Mini Mini (R57) in Red with a 1,598c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 15 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 86.7%.
Across all 2010 Mini Mini (R57) models, the average MOT pass rate is 79.8% with a typical mileage of 55,108 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Mini Mini (R57) fails its MOT is windscreen wiper does not clear the windscreen effectively, accounting for 365 recorded failures. If you're considering buying BT10 OPX,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Mini Mini (R57) typically stays on UK roads for around 19 years. At 16 years old, this Mini Mini (R57) is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
